One year anniversary of PAGOSTE

Dear readers, today our project celebrates its first year of implementation and we are glad to share with you a short summary of what happened during this project year

One year ago (on 15 January 2020) the Erasmus+ project PAGOSTE started. It is a relatively short period of time, however, we can be proud of the achieved results for this period. Despite numerous external challenges our project consortium has faced this year, we have managed to adapt, turn them into opportunities and embrace the changes. 

We would like to present a short summary of our project implementation for the first year according to each work package.

Work Package 1:  Analysis of governance of vocational teacher education

All planned deliverables were produced, most of them are in two languages. The unplanned deliverable, the report on the Implementation of the Self-competences and Convictions’ Perception Questionnaire (QPCC) to VET teachers in Ukraine enriched the data and the conclusions of the need analysis. The planned activities except for the first kick-off workshop were converted into online events.

Work Package 2: Elaboration and implementation of PBG

Ukrainian partner-HEIs have started to work on the concepts how to cooperate with vocational schools and other stakeholders in the most beneficial way so the relevance and quality of vocational teacher training at their HEIs increase and new opportunities for the in-service teacher training are opened. The starting point is the institutional reports on the need analysis and the structural report. The second project workshop was organised online. The next nearest event is the round table (scheduled for March). Ukrainian partner-HEIs and the coordinating institution have started the cumbersome process of the equipment purchase.

Work Package 3Content input from European partners on PBG

The first two staff trainings were organised online in November-December 2020. Though the online format will hardly be able to substitute the live events, it has one enormous advantage – it allows expanding the geography. Thus, VET teachers, HEI academic staff and stakeholders from all over Ukraine took part in the staff trainings and received their certificates. 

Work Package 4: Setting up PBG mechanisms for the national level

The development of the online platform has started under the leadership of the Institute of Vocational Education and Training in close cooperation with all Ukrainian partners and contribution from the European partners. The structure and preliminary design are going to be presented with during the coming project meetings and an official presentation to the target groups is planned for the round table in March. 

Work Package 5: Quality assurance of the project

The quality assurance strategy and the necessary evaluation instruments have been developed. The produced deliverables were peer-reviewed by the project partners according to the quality assurance mechanisms. The first results of event evaluations are on the way. The project partners have also submitted their work progress reports for the first year, which helped them to reflect the project implementation, their achievements, obligations to fulfil and problems to tackle.  

Ukrainian partners successfully participated in the preventive field monitoring, which was performed by the National Erasmus+ Office in Ukraine, and obtained positive feedback.

Work Package 6: Project dissemination plan and exploitation of results

The dissemination strategy has been developed. Based on it, each Ukrainian partner-HEI created its own dissemination plan for three years. Kyiv National Economic University supervises the implementation of the dissemination plans in Ukraine and leads the work package. All news, updates and deliverables are uploaded to the project website and disseminated on the official Facebook page PAGOSTE. The first newsletters have been produced in two languages and disseminated among target groups.
